Kino to Release USA's First Silent Feature on Blu-ray! Posted by: Iggy 9/30/09. Buster Keaton's masterpiece, 'The General,' will be released on Blu-ray November 10th. This is a rather important Blu-ray release as it marks the first silent feature to be released on Blu-ray in the United States.The video has been remastered in full 1080p using the original 35mm source and the audio will contain multiple tracks featuring the movie's score including a 5.1 track and a 2.0 track. Extras included are a tour of the filming locations, commentary, introductions and a deeper look at Buster Keaton. This 1927 classic can be found for $22.99 at Amazon by clicking here.

HDMI 1.4 Official! Posted by Iggy on 5/28/09.
HDMI has been a major component in changing the way we watch television and movies, and now it’s going even further. HDMI 1.4 has been officially announced with many positive additions to the ‘miracle cable’. HDMI 1.4 will add support for Ethernet connection, audio return, 4K and 2K playback, and 3D picture. There will also be a mini HDMI connection (about half the size) that will allow more options for portable and smaller devices.
Along with all the positive does come one major negative though. For the first time, and HDMI cable is no longer just an HDMI cable. There will be a variety of different HDMI cables, each doing at least one of the new features listed above meaning more money spent by the consumer. 'Midnight Express' scheduled to arrive on Blu-ray, July 21st! Posted by: Randell 5/12/09. The classic suspense drama about an American college student's terrifying and nightmarish experience in a Turkish prison for attempting to smuggle hashish finally escapes as a Deluxe Blu-ray High-Def book. The source of much controversy due to its portrayal of Turkish authorities, the film saw Oliver Stone's first Oscar for adapting the novel. 'Midnight Express' (inmate slang for "an escape" under cover of night) was directed by Sir Alan Parker and stars Bo Hopkins, Randy Quaid, and John Hurt. Tech specs are limited, but expect a 1080p/AVC MPEG-4 video presentation in the film's original 1.85:1 aspect ratio and English Dolby TrueHD. Exclusives include not only BD-Live capabilities, but also a 32-page photo and essay booklet from Parker's own personal journal. Suggested retail price for this Deluxe Blu-ray edition of 'Midnight Express' is set at $38.96.

Warner's New Red2Blu Program! Posted by Iggy on 4/22/09. Warner Brothers finally made every 'dual format' owner's dreams come true with the announcement of their new Red2Blu program. That's right, you can now trade in your existing HD DVDs for the same exact title on Blu-ray for a very small fee of $4.95 per title. Currently this is only offered by Warner Brothers and there are some restrictions, but if it runs successful I wouldn't be surprised to see some other studios follow suit. Hi-Hoing its way to Blu-ray this Fall is Disney's animated classic 'Snow White'! Posted by: Randell 4/3/09. Opening its vaults once again, Disney Home Entertainment will release Walt Disney's first feature-length animated film for high definition on October 6th, almost two months before the standard definition DVD release. Marking a major milestone in the world of animation, 'Snow White and the Seven Dwarfs' is honored with being one of the first films ever to be designated for preservation by the Library of Congress and the first to have a motion picture soundtrack, as well as the first film that uses music to advance the story. As one of the most beloved and most watched films in history, Disney will package the highly-acclaimed and highly-anticipated classic as a Blu-ray + DVD Combo Pack (2 Blu-ray discs + DVD) and will include a spectacular assortment of all new bonus features.Tech specs include an AVC MPEG-4 video presentation (1.33:1) and English 7.1 DTS-HD Master Audio. Suggested retail price for this Platinum Edition Blu-ray of 'Snow White and the Seven Dwarfs' is set at $39.99.
